Researchers To Upgrade Safety And Performance Of Rocket Fuel
Researchers at the University of Massachusetts Amherst have received a $1 million grant from the U. S. Department of Defense (DoD) to boost the safety and performance of fuel used in thousands of satellites, space vehicles, rockets and missiles.
